    I'll just start out by stating that Matshita/Panasonic drives are crap for the most part. That said, the CD media you're using is not of very good quality and may be accounting for the power calibration errors. The same error can also be caused by out of date firmware and hardware failure.

    I assume this laptop OEM burner came with the system, so you'll have to look for a firmware update on the computer vendor's support site.

    Try using some different CD media. Try Verbatim.

    I noticed a burn speed of 4X. Was this a CDRW disk or a CDR disk. I'm guessing CDRW given the slow speed. Try a CDR instead.
